Ofcom consumer research has come out with its new report which claims that the Orange provides the tardiest mobile internet service in the UK. The company’s 3G service is used by almost 17 percent of UK household, which provides average speed of about 1.4Mbps only. O2, on the other hand, provides the fastest 3G service. [...]

Despite O2 being one of the key Apple retailers in the UK they are seemingly unimpressed by the iPad 2. In a surprise announcement the network provider said that it will not be stocking the iPad 2 when it launches in the UK on 25 March. There is no explanation as to why they have [...]
